在Debian系統中,你可以使用多種工具來提取網絡數據。以下是一些常用的命令行工具:
tcpdump:這是一個強大的網絡分析工具,可以捕獲和分析經過網絡接口的數據包。
安裝tcpdump:
sudo apt-get update
sudo apt-get install tcpdump
使用tcpdump捕獲數據包:
sudo tcpdump -i eth0
其中eth0是你的網絡接口名稱,你可以使用ifconfig或ip addr命令來查看。
wireshark:這是一個圖形界面的網絡協議分析器,提供了比tcpdump更友好的用戶界面。
安裝wireshark:
sudo apt-get update
sudo apt-get install wireshark
運行wireshark:
wireshark
ngrep:這是一個基于grep的網絡數據包分析工具,可以用來搜索網絡數據流中的特定模式。
安裝ngrep:
sudo apt-get update
sudo apt-get install ngrep
使用ngrep搜索數據包:
sudo ngrep -d eth0 port 80
這將捕獲所有經過eth0接口且目標端口為80的數據包。
iftop:這是一個實時顯示網絡帶寬使用情況的工具。
安裝iftop:
sudo apt-get update
sudo apt-get install iftop
運行iftop:
sudo iftop -i eth0
其中eth0是你的網絡接口名稱。
nload:這是一個實時監控網絡流量的工具,以圖形化的方式顯示入站和出站流量。
安裝nload:
sudo apt-get update
sudo apt-get install nload
運行nload:
nload
這些工具可以幫助你提取和分析Debian系統中的網絡數據。根據你的需求選擇合適的工具,并確保你有足夠的權限(通常需要root權限)來執行這些命令。